Answered 7 months ago
No, Institute of Management & Technology (IMT), Faridabad is not under CUET. IMT Faridabad is affiliated with Maharshi Dayanand University (MDU), Rohtak, and offers admissions based on merit and entrance exams, not CUET scores.
